plain, field, champaign(noun)extensive tract of level open land
"they emerged from the woods onto a vast open plain"; "he longed for the fields of his youth"
knit, knit stitch, plain, plain stitch(adj)a basic knitting stitch
apparent, evident, manifest, patent, plain, unmistakable(adj)clearly revealed to the mind or the senses or judgment
"the effects of the drought are apparent to anyone who sees the parched fields"; "evident hostility"; "manifest disapproval"; "patent advantages"; "made his meaning plain"; "it is plain that he is no reactionary"; "in plain view"
plain(adj)not elaborate or elaborated; simple
"plain food"; "stuck to the plain facts"; "a plain blue suit"; "a plain rectangular brick building"
plain, unpatterned(adj)lacking patterns especially in color
plain, sheer, unmingled, unmixed(adj)not mixed with extraneous elements
"plain water"; "sheer wine"; "not an unmixed blessing"
plain, unvarnished(adj)free from any effort to soften to disguise
"the plain and unvarnished truth"; "the unvarnished candor of old people and children"
plain, bare, spare, unembellished, unornamented(adj)lacking embellishment or ornamentation
"a plain hair style"; "unembellished white walls"; "functional architecture featuring stark unornamented concrete"
homely, plain(verb)lacking in physical beauty or proportion
"a homely child"; "several of the buildings were downright homely"; "a plain girl with a freckled face"
complain, kick, plain, sound off, quetch, kvetch(adverb)express complaints, discontent, displeasure, or unhappiness
"My mother complains all day"; "She has a lot to kick about"
obviously, evidently, manifestly, patently, apparently, plainly, plain(adverb)unmistakably (`plain' is often used informally for `plainly')
"the answer is obviously wrong"; "she was in bed and evidently in great pain"; "he was manifestly too important to leave off the guest list"; "it is all patently nonsense"; "she has apparently been living here for some time"; "I thought he owned the property, but apparently not"; "You are plainly wrong"; "he is plain stubborn"
free from all additions or embellishment I like my hamburgers plain, with no ketchup or relishjust give us the plain facts and none of your snide comments
free from added matterI'd prefer my pasta plain, not flavored with tomato or spinach or anything else
free in expressing one's true feelings and opinionstheir piano teacher is honest and plain, if not always tactful
going straight to the point clearly and firmlya plain report on the current situation
not subject to misinterpretation or more than one interpretationlet me make my meaning plain
in an honest and direct mannertold her plain that he loved her
a broad area of level or rolling treeless countrythe first settlers in that area lived on the vast plains in lonely log cabins
a wide space or areathe vast plains of snow-covered earth that seemed to stretch endlessly
